Frequently Asked Questions about Northampton County

How much are Studio apartments in Northampton County?

There are currently 86 Studio Apartments in Northampton County with rent ranges from $950 to $1,859 with an average price of $1,448.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Northampton County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Northampton County ranges from $950 to $7,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,816.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Northampton County c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Northampton County range from $1,275 to $167,516.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,538.

How expensive are Northampton County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 98 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Northampton County on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,450 to $3,300 - averaging $2,183 for the location.
